    The P-Shot, also known as the Priapus Shot, is a non-surgical treatment designed to enhance male sexual performance and address issues such as erectile dysfunction. The longevity of the effects of the P-Shot can vary from person to person, influenced by factors such as age, overall health, and lifestyle. Generally, the benefits of the P-Shot can last anywhere from 12 to 18 months. Some individuals may experience longer-lasting effects, potentially up to 2 years, while others might notice a gradual decline after a year.

    To maximize the duration of the P-Shot's benefits, it is recommended to maintain a healthy lifestyle, including regular exercise, a balanced diet, and avoiding smoking and excessive alcohol consumption. Additionally, follow-up consultations with your healthcare provider can help monitor progress and determine if any additional treatments or adjustments are needed to sustain the desired results.

    It's important to note that while the P-Shot can provide significant improvements in sexual health, individual results may vary. Consulting with a qualified medical professional in Phoenix can provide personalized insights and expectations regarding the longevity of the P-Shot's effects.

    What is the P-Shot?

    The P-Shot, or Priapus Shot, is a non-surgical procedure designed to rejuvenate the penis using platelet-rich plasma (PRP). PRP is derived from the patient's own blood, which is processed to concentrate the platelets. These platelets contain growth factors that stimulate tissue regeneration and improve blood flow. The procedure involves injecting the PRP into specific areas of the penis to enhance sensitivity, size, and overall function.

    How Long Do the Effects Last?

    The longevity of the P-Shot effects can vary among individuals due to several factors, including overall health, lifestyle, and the specific goals of the treatment. Generally, patients can expect the benefits to last anywhere from 12 to 18 months. Some individuals may experience effects that persist for up to two years, while others might require periodic touch-up treatments to maintain optimal results.

    Factors Influencing Duration

    Several factors can influence how long the effects of the P-Shot last:

    1. Overall Health: A healthy lifestyle, including regular exercise, a balanced diet, and avoiding smoking and excessive alcohol consumption, can help prolong the effects of the P-Shot.
    2. Age: Younger patients may experience longer-lasting results due to better overall tissue regeneration capabilities.
    3. Pre-existing Conditions: Conditions such as diabetes or cardiovascular diseases can affect blood flow and may shorten the duration of the P-Shot's benefits.
    4. Follow-Up Care: Adhering to post-treatment care instructions and maintaining regular follow-up appointments can help sustain the effects.
